Sec. 3872.157. OPERATION AND MAINTENANCE TAX. (a) If authorized at an election held in accordance with Section 3872.161, the district may impose an operation and maintenance tax on taxable property in the district in accordance with Section 49.107, Water Code, for any district purpose, including to:
(1) maintain and operate the district;
(2) construct or acquire improvements; or
(3) provide a service.
(b) The board shall determine the tax rate. The rate may not exceed the rate approved at the election.
Added by Acts 2009, 81st Leg., R.S., Ch. 873 (S.B. 2511), Sec. 1, eff. June 19, 2009.
